Do probiotics reduce TMAO?
While TMAO did not change after probiotic supplementation, there was a significant increase in betaine plasma levels. In contrast, the placebo group showed a significant decrease in plasma choline levels. Short-term probiotic supplementation does not appear to influence plasma TMAO levels in HD patients.
Simply so, What foods increase TMAO? TMAO levels in the blood significantly increase after eating TMAO-rich food such as fish and vegetables. In addition, the liver produces TMAO from trimethylamine (TMA), a substance made by gut bacteria.
Do eggs increase TMAO? A randomized controlled study indicates that the consumption of 2 or more eggs significantly increases the TMAO in blood and urine, with a choline conversion rate to TMAO of approximately 14%.

Research suggests that subjects with high TMAO should consider switching to a heart-healthy Mediterranean or plant-based diet, since adherence to the Mediterranean diet has been shown to reduce TMAO levels.
What causes high TMAO?
TMAO (trimethylamine N-oxide) is produced by gut bacteria from choline, lecithin, and L-carnitine-rich foods (mainly fish, meat, egg, and dairy). High levels are associated with heart disease, hardening of the arteries, diabetes, and colon cancer.

How can I lower my TMAO naturally?
To lower your TMAO levels, consider minimizing the consumption of full-fat dairy products, including whole milk, egg yolk, cream cheese, and butter; both processed and unprocessed red meat (beef, pork, lamb, and veal), as well as nutritional supplements and energy drinks containing choline, phosphatidylcholine ( …

What does TMAO do in the body? Trimethylamine N-oxide (TMAO) is a small colorless amine oxide generated from choline, betaine, and carnitine by gut microbial metabolism. It accumulates in the tissue of marine animals in high concentrations and protects against the protein-destabilizing effects of urea.
Does fish contain TMAO?
Fish and other seafoods contain significant quantities of free TMAO, in addition to the TMA precursors (phosphatidylcholine, choline, and carnitine) found in meat, eggs, and milk products.
Does L-carnitine increase TMAO? L-carnitine, which can be metabolized to TMA, is a primary metabolic precursor for TMAO. Dietary L-carnitine supplementation can significantly increase serum TMAO levels in both human and rodents (4, 13). Oral L-carnitine treatment could also promote atherosclerosis in ApoE knockout mice (10).
Is Salmon High in TMAO?
The TMAO content is higher in cod compared to salmon [28], and we recently demonstrated that high cod intake, but not high salmon intake, markedly increased the TMAO concentration in serum and urine of this study population as a result of high TMAO intake from cod fillet [28].
How is TMA formed?
TMA and DMA are produced from trimethylamine oxide (TMAO) by spoilage bacteria. Ammonia can be formed by various catabolic routes such as the decomposition of urea, amino acids and nucleotides by urease and deaminase.
Is TMAO carcinogenic? For example, TMAO was suggested to be involved in molecular pathways that lead to the generation of N-nitroso compounds 66, which were known to induce DNA damage, an event that can contribute to carcinogenesis 67. This suggests a potential involvement of DNA damage in TMAO-contributed carcinogenesis.
Does TMAO cause inflammation?
AS is considered a chronic inflammatory disease initiated by vascular endothelial inflammatory injury. Both observational and experimental studies suggest that TMAO can cause endothelial inflammatory injury. However, a clear mechanistic link between TMAO and vascular inflammation of AS is not yet summarized.

How is TMAO excreted? Approximately 50% of the ingested TMAO is absorbed unchanged and then excreted in urine. The remaining 50% is converted into TMA in the gut by the action of TMAO reductase [19]. TMA can be oxidized to TMAO again by the action of TMA monooxigenase, which is present in some gut microorganisms [21,22] (Figure 1).

What is TMAO egg? Eggs, and especially egg yolks, are a major dietary source of choline. Choline can also be given as a dietary supplement. Ingestion of choline supplements has been linked to an increased concentration of a compound called TMAO (trimethylamine N-oxide). Elevated TMAO levels have been linked to higher heart disease risk.
What is the difference between TMA and TMAO?
Choline, a trimethylamine-containing compound and part of the head group of phosphatidylcholine, is metabolized by gut microbiota to produce an intermediate compound known as trimethylamine (TMA). TMA is rapidly further oxidized by hepatic flavin monooxygenases to form trimethylamine N-oxide (TMAO).
How does TMAO cause atherosclerosis? TMAO is identified as a promoter of atherosclerosis by enhancing the formation of foam cells and atherogenic plaque in mice [4], [5]. However, the underlying mechanism that how TMAO promotes atherosclerosis is not fully understood. Endothelial dysfunction plays a role in the pathogenesis of atherosclerosis.
How do you treat trimethylaminuria?
Treatment for trimethylaminuria mainly includes diet modification, acidic soaps and lotions, and vitamin B12 supplements. Other treatment options include antibiotics , activated charcoal, and probiotics.
Where is TMAO found? Trimethylamine (TMA) is formed in the intestinal lumen when gut microbiota metabolize carnitine, choline, and choline-containing compounds in the diet. TMA can be absorbed from the intestine. This absorbed TMA is delivered to the liver where flavin-dependent monooxygenase (FMO) isoforms 1 and 3 convert it to TMAO.
